Transaction 34cab832eb9631039ca88d5e8fb86a0b696c41512a00ebabe60a65dee16fded8
1 Input
1 Output
-
34cab832eb9631039ca88d5e8fb86a0b696c41512a00ebabe60a65dee16fded8:0
- value
- 60200000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 954bf70cbe54d28a7836d116eb7858943fc13907 OP_EQUAL
- address
- MMWZvA24ypEE2Wicrh8TDRy7aoDtoenN2K